From 36244262595ff75bbc7305bc3816fc50d19a733f Mon Sep 17 00:00:00 2001
From: Joshi <3040996759@qq.com>
Date: Wed, 14 Jan 2026 14:19:44 +0800
Subject: [PATCH] =?UTF-8?q?fix(delivery-plan):=20=E4=BF=AE=E6=AD=A3?=
=?UTF-8?q?=E9=85=8D=E9=80=81=E8=AE=A1=E5=88=92=E6=9F=A5=E8=AF=A2=E7=9A=84?=
=?UTF-8?q?=E5=88=86=E7=BB=84=E9=80=BB=E8=BE=91?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
- 在统计查询中添加按计划日期分组,确保相同计划名称但不同日期的数据正确分离
- 为日期范围查询结果添加按计划日期分组,避免数据重复统计
- 优化GROUP BY子句以提高查询准确性和性能
---
.../src/main/resources/mapper/klp/WmsDeliveryPlanMapper.xml |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/klp-wms/src/main/resources/mapper/klp/WmsDeliveryPlanMapper.xml b/klp-wms/src/main/resources/mapper/klp/WmsDeliveryPlanMapper.xml
index d43583ee..6fbd4297 100644
--- a/klp-wms/src/main/resources/mapper/klp/WmsDeliveryPlanMapper.xml
+++ b/klp-wms/src/main/resources/mapper/klp/WmsDeliveryPlanMapper.xml
@@ -161,7 +161,7 @@
AND wcpa.create_time <= #{endTime}
- GROUP BY dp.plan_name
+ GROUP BY dp.plan_name, dp.plan_date
ORDER BY taskCount DESC
@@ -195,6 +195,7 @@
AND wcpa.create_time <= #{endTime}
+ GROUP BY dp.plan_date